Vicious Cycle is the weekly comedy podcast that seeks to demystify, bitch about and laugh at periods.

Beyond interviewing gynecologists, trans folks who bleed and OUR MOMS, we've also snagged interviews with
-comedians Joann Schinderle, Francesca Fiorentini and Luna Malbroux
-Vox/MSNBC journalist/author Liz Plank
-Producer of the Oscar-winning film “Period: End of Sentence” Sophie Ascheim

We're in our 3rd season and have a dedicated group of fans who call themselves blisteners (bleeding listeners - our show is a lot of puns) who share their stories with us through our hotline: 910-6-UTERUS. It has a jingle.

ABOUT YOUR CO-BLOSTS
Kate Elston, Meg Hayes and Meg Trowbridge are experts in menstruation and have been bleeders for decades, even though we often forget to pack extra tampons. We’re BFFs and have been improvising for 10+ years with The Ballroom (formerly Chinese Ballroom). We also write/direct/act with San Francisco's premiere sketch group Killing My Lobster. Kate is a journalist/producer, Meg Hayes is a public school teacher and Meg Trowbridge is a professional writer and VERY good singer who makes the other two look bad. (Free, 21+)
